diff options
author | asvitkine@chromium.org <asvitkine@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-11-21 18:33:30 +0000 |
---|---|---|
committer | asvitkine@chromium.org <asvitkine@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-11-21 18:33:30 +0000 |
commit | 0edf876ba2cbb70bad416c3e5c45372fe919c3d2 (patch) | |
tree | 1b498bd097dbabc591bf14e98171a1daf161ee9d /chrome_frame | |
parent | a6ef2fbc8a888d1b6278ca7b912861927581ba3e (diff) | |
download | chromium_src-0edf876ba2cbb70bad416c3e5c45372fe919c3d2.zip chromium_src-0edf876ba2cbb70bad416c3e5c45372fe919c3d2.tar.gz chromium_src-0edf876ba2cbb70bad416c3e5c45372fe919c3d2.tar.bz2 |
Small refactor to MetricsLog stability functionality.
This CL simplifies some MetricsLog APIs, consolidating
RecordEnvironment and RecordEnvironmentProto as well as
RecordIncrementalStabilityElements and WriteStabilityElement.
This reduces the MetricsLog API surface, simplifying things
for some upcoming changes I'm planning to make (recording
startup stability stats separately from startup histograms
and profiler data).
No changes to logic/functionality.
BUG=312733, 109818
TEST=Existing unit tests.
TBR=grt@chromium.org
Review URL: https://codereview.chromium.org/69603003
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@236551 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ome_frame')
-rw-r--r-- | chrome_frame/metrics_service.cc |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/chrome_frame/metrics_service.cc b/chrome_frame/metrics_service.cc index 515068f..8ccc1e5 100644 --- a/chrome_frame/metrics_service.cc +++ b/chrome_frame/metrics_service.cc @@ -364,8 +364,8 @@ void MetricsService::StartRecording() { if (log_manager_.current_log()) return; - MetricsLogManager::LogType log_type = (state_ == INITIALIZED) ? - MetricsLogManager::INITIAL_LOG : MetricsLogManager::ONGOING_LOG; + MetricsLogBase::LogType log_type = (state_ == INITIALIZED) ? + MetricsLogBase::INITIAL_LOG : MetricsLogBase::ONGOING_LOG; log_manager_.BeginLoggingWithLog(new MetricsLogBase(GetClientID(), session_id_, GetVersionString()), |